Internship Location: Centurion, Gauteng

Internship Closing Date:January 20, 2024

Purpose of Role:

Nokia South Africa invites fresh graduates to join its dynamic team, offering boundless networking opportunities. The company is at the forefront of technological innovation, pushing the boundaries with projects such as putting networks on the moon and developing 6G technology. As a graduate at Nokia, you’ll have the chance to accelerate the world’s potential, build hyper-efficient architectures, and contribute to cutting-edge advancements like bio-optical sensors.

Responsibilities:

Nokia is offering internship opportunities for recently graduated university students with relevant tertiary qualifications. The responsibilities include:

  • Acquiring theoretical knowledge and practical training.
  • Participating in workplace and simulated workplace training.
  • Engaging in external integrated summative assessments.
  • Developing effective communication skills.

Tertiary Education Requirements:

  • Marketing and communications degree, specializing in design and audio-visual qualifications.
  • Supply chain management or procurement-related qualifications.
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Business Management.

Soft Skills Requirements:

  • Proficiency in Office 365 applications, ideally Power BI.
  • Excellent English skills (verbal and written).
  • Strong desire to learn and develop professionally.
  • Team collaboration and hands-on mentality.
  • Drive for results and ability to work under pressure.

What are the benefits of an internship?

Internships offer various benefits for both students and organizations. Here are some key advantages:

  1. Hands-on Experience: Internships provide students with practical, real-world experience in their chosen field. This hands-on experience is invaluable and allows interns to apply theoretical knowledge from the classroom to actual work situations.
  2. Skill Development: Internships help students develop and enhance a wide range of skills, including technical skills related to their field of study as well as soft skills such as communication, teamwork, time management, and problem-solving.
  3. Networking Opportunities: Internships provide a platform for students to build professional networks. They can connect with experienced professionals, mentors, and peers, which can be beneficial for future career opportunities.
  4. Resume Enhancement: Having an internship on a resume is a significant asset when entering the job market. It demonstrates to employers that the candidate has practical experience and is familiar with the demands of the workplace.
  5. Industry Insight: Internships give students a firsthand look into the daily operations of a specific industry or company. This exposure helps them understand the industry culture, trends, and the types of challenges they might face in their future careers.
  6. Confidence Building: Through successfully completing tasks and projects during an internship, students gain confidence in their abilities. This newfound confidence can be crucial when transitioning from academia to the professional world.
  7. Job Opportunities: Many companies use internships as a recruitment tool. If an intern performs well and fits into the organizational culture, there’s a possibility of being offered a full-time position after graduation.
  8. Career Exploration: Internships allow students to explore different aspects of their chosen field. They may discover specific areas they enjoy or find that their interests lie in a different direction, helping them make more informed career decisions.
  9. Professional Development: Internships expose students to professional work environments, helping them understand workplace etiquette, professional communication, and the expectations of employers.
  10. References and Recommendations: A successful internship can lead to positive references and recommendations from supervisors or colleagues. These endorsements can be valuable assets when applying for future positions.
